Improper Sizing of Heatpump



When it pertains to the installment of heatpump, among the most typical mistakes is improperly sizing the device for your space. Ensuring the appropriate dimension is important for ideal efficiency. If the heatpump is too small, it will have a hard time to warm or cool your space successfully, leading to increased energy bills and possible damage on the unit.



On the other hand, if the heat pump is too large, it will cycle on and off regularly, creating temperature level changes and lowering its lifespan.

To prevent this mistake, it's necessary to have a professional evaluate your room and recommend the proper dimension of the heat pump based on elements like square video footage, insulation, ceiling elevation, and local environment. By investing the moment and effort to ensure the proper sizing, you can appreciate a comfy environment while taking full advantage of power performance and lengthening the lifespan of your heatpump.

Inadequate Insulation and Sealing



To make sure the reliable procedure of your heat pump, it's critical to deal with poor insulation and securing in your space. Proper insulation assists preserve a consistent temperature inside your home, reducing the work on your heatpump. Inadequate insulation can bring about power loss, making your heatpump work harder and less effectively.

Securing any type of gaps or leakages in your area is equally vital. These spaces allow conditioned air to escape and outdoor air to seep in, compeling your heat pump to compensate for the temperature variations.

Inaccurate Placement of Outdoor Device

One common error to avoid is positioning the outside system also near a wall or other frameworks. This can restrict air movement, causing the device to work harder to heat or cool your space, ultimately minimizing its performance and life expectancy.

An additional mistake to stay away from is placing the exterior unit in straight sunlight. While some sunlight is inescapable, extreme direct exposure can cause overheating, especially throughout warm summertime days. It's ideal to position the outdoor system in a shaded location to assist preserve its ideal operating temperature level.

Moreover, see to it that the exterior system is placed on a secure and level surface. Irregular ground can cause vibrations and unnecessary stress on the system, affecting its performance over time.
